Output 66e6d859b76fbb6edf055ab565a5d0d40180b33350862cdf3e4ce37e9d778683:0

value
2109513
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ff6547199974d5896ed1d50fe3899dcad5582bf3 OP_EQUALVERIFY OP_CHECKSIG
address
1QHQdpPkB5AinreJ42kHrySoP3hiYJkfRw
transaction
66e6d859b76fbb6edf055ab565a5d0d40180b33350862cdf3e4ce37e9d778683
spent
true